What You'll Do
Inspection of own work using quality standards and work instructions.
Conduct pull tests as needed for particular operations
Measure components using calipers, gages, or other measuring devices.
Inspect product to print
Complete necessary operational paperwork required to maintain the traceability of product
May troubleshoot and perform minor repairs to equipment.
General housekeeping of work area
Follow company and department guidelines, procedures and policies.
Follow safety guidelines
Perform all other work-related duties as assigned
Read and perform tasks according to drawings

Physical Demands
Must be able to sit or stand for extended periods, use hands for fine motor tasks such as handling or feeling objects, reach with arms and hands, and communicate effectively through speech and hearing
The role also requires the ability to handle small components under a microscope for prolonged durations
Regular physical demands include lifting and/or moving up to 10 pounds routinely, up to 25 pounds frequently, and occasionally up to 50 pounds
Safety shoes are required
